How 97006 compares

ZIP 97006 is a mid-priced ZIP code for Beaverton: its typical home value of $494,000 ranks #3 of the 6 Beaverton ZIP codes we track (the citywide range runs from $482,000 in 97003 to $594,000 in 97007). Per square foot it costs about $285, against $292 for Beaverton as a whole, $299 for Oregon, and $195 nationally.

AreaTypical value$ / sq ft
ZIP 97006$494,000$285
Beaverton, OR$494,000$292
Oregon$468,500$299
United States$294,000$195

Salary needed to buy a home in ZIP 97006

To buy the typical $494,000 home in ZIP 97006 with 20% down, you need a household income of roughly $134,000 a year (about $3,140 a month for the mortgage, taxes, and insurance). With 10% down the bar rises to about $160,000, because the loan is bigger and mortgage insurance kicks in.

Down paymentCash downMonthly paymentIncome needed
5% (+PMI)$24,700$3,900/mo$167,000/yr
10% (+PMI)$49,400$3,730/mo$160,000/yr
20%$98,800$3,140/mo$134,000/yr

Assumes a 30-year fixed mortgage at 6.5%, property tax at 1.1% and insurance at 0.45% of value per year, PMI of 0.75% on loans with less than 20% down, and the standard 28% housing-to-income rule. Your rate, taxes, and HOA will move these — run your own numbers in the mortgage calculator.
